H3000 Loadcell sentence NMEA 0183

Used boat with an H3000 CPU. The H3000's NMEA 0183 OUT is connected to a Shipmodul Miniplex3-WI-N2K, which in turn is plugged into a USB port on the nav PC.

All the other instrument sensors are being output by the H3000 and passing throug the mux but I can't see anything resembling the load cell data. Does anyone know what 0183 sentence the H3000 has assigned to the H3000?

I haven't yet connected the PC to the H3000, but as the USB driver for Windows has a load error under Windows 10, I haven't beeen able to connect, amd I haven't resorted to getting a RS232 cable yet.

Re: H3000 Loadcell sentence NMEA 0183

I don't think you can get load cell data over NMEA 0183, unless it is in an XDR sentence.

Yes, I don't think H3 sends anything like this over NMEA 0183.

​There isn't a USB driver available for 64 bit computers.
